Eau de Vie
Eau de Vie, meaning ‘water of life’ is a pretty amazing cocktail bar. The Darlinghurst bar has won countless awards, since its opening in 2010, and has well and truly cemented its spot as one of the hottest cocktail bars in Sydney. And, for good reason.
This is a bar, you need to know about. It’s located inside the Kirketon Hotel. If you didn’t know better, you would never realise the oasis waiting for you inside. And, poor you, if that is the case. But, fear not. Consider yourself now in the know (if you are not already). You can thank us later.
Walk through the hotel entrance, past the restaurant on your right hand side, and towards the unmarked black glass doors. Walk down the corridor, past the bathrooms and enter Eau de Vie.
This is a sophisticated speakeasy, full of class, with a 1930′s feel. Think dark lighting, ornate lamps and plush couches. Jazz music is playing, and the bartenders (all men) are dressed with bracers and bow-ties, complete with gelled hair.
The cocktail menu reads like a novel, with entertaining descriptions and caricatures of the creators of their signature cocktails. The barmen take their drinks very seriously here. You get the feeling they view cocktail making as an art form. It’s a well oiled machine and everything works seamlessly.
To compliment their cocktail menu, a food menu is offered, comprising canapes, dishes designed to share, cheese boards and the like.
